Need SAMBA expert Please help...
I have setup a samba share on my SuSE 10.2 Enterprise server. I want files to be locked if a user has one open. Currently two users can edit the same file. So the last user to edit wins the changes. What am I missing? Below is my smb.conf file:
[global] server string = lewis3 map to guest = Bad User printcap name = cups logon path = \\%L\profiles\.msprofile logon drive = P: logon home = \\%L\%U\.9xprofile ldap ssl = no lock directory = /var/lock/samba usershare allow guests = Yes printing = cups cups options = raw print command = lpq command = %p lprm command = oplocks = No level2 oplocks = No strict locking = Yes include = /etc/samba/dhcp.conf [homes] comment = Home Directories valid users = %S, %D%w%S read only = No inherit acls = Yes browseable = No [profiles] comment = Network Profiles Service path = %H read only = No create mask = 0600 directory mask = 0700 store dos attributes = Yes [users] comment = All users path = /home read only = No inherit acls = Yes veto files = /aquota.user/groups/shares/ [groups] comment = All groups path = /home/groups read only = No inherit acls = Yes [printers] comment = All Printers path = /var/tmp create mask = 0600 printable = Yes browseable = No [print$] comment = Printer Drivers path = /var/lib/samba/drivers write list = @ntadmin, root force group = ntadmin create mask = 0664 directory mask = 0775 [buyers] comment = Buyers Share path = /winshare/buyers read only = No create mask = 0774 The buyers section is the important share. Thanks |
According to my quick read of man smb.conf, strict locking is a per share parameter not a global, so you may need to set in in the share definition for it to take effect.
Ditto for leve2 oplocks and oplocks |
[buyers]
comment = Buyers Share path = /winshare/buyers read only = No create mask = 0774 oplocks = No level2 oplocks = No strict locking = Yes Even with this configuration I don't see a change. All users can still edit the file. I restarted smbd and nmbd only. I have also tried this configuration [buyers] comment = Buyers Share path = /winshare/buyers read only = No create mask = 0774 oplocks = Yes level2 oplocks = Yes strict locking = Yes |
Another thing I've noticed from the STATUS page of SWAT there are Active Connections and Active Shares (both of which have data below them), but it DOES NOT show Open Files. Even when I have the same file open on both Windows XP PC's. I've refreshed for 5 minutes now and it will not show the files as open.
